  3. Index number: a ratio used to show % changes over time They allow us to compare prices, products, sales figures, and more for a given period of time against an earlier period of time. The earlier period of time is called the base period. given year’s value Index number = X 100 base year’s value

  6. Chebyshev’s Theorem In any population or sample… Let k be any number equal to or greater than 1, Then the proportion of any distribution that lies Within k standard deviations of the mean is at least… 1 - 1 k2

  10. New York rated its top 5 pizza companies and San Francisco did the same, but they used different scales. A high score shows that people enjoyed the pizza. The results are: X – X s z-score of x = Which brand has the least taste appeal? At first glance, David’s seems to be the lowest. But since there were different scales and other relative scores to consider, we must find the z-score.
